After returning from America, she felt drawn toward a career that would allow her to travel faster and further, aviation.
Her decision to move to Dubai and join Emirates Airlines was the start of a new chapter. Over nearly five years, Daiana Crimpita flew across six continents and visited more than 100 countries. Her twenties became a thrilling mix of adventure, learning, and cultural discovery.
Living in Dubai gave her the perfect balance between exploration and self-growth. Alongside her aviation career, Daiana Crimpita pursued her passion for fashion modeling, participating in major events like Dubai Fashion Week. Her path was far from easy. At age 20, she volunteered for six months with a non-governmental organization in Cairo, which opened her eyes to different realities. Soon after, she took part in a European Commission project in Italy and joined numerous youth training programs across Europe. These experiences shaped her understanding of the world and fueled her desire to give back.
One milestone she cherishes most is reaching her 100th country, Socotra, Yemen, last year. For Daiana Crimpita, traveling is not just a passion, it is a core part of her identity. It has shaped how she sees the world and herself.

Aviation is a family tradition for Daiana Crimpita. Her father was a helicopter pilot in the Romanian Air Forces, often taking her to helicopters and planes as a child. Her aunt flies for Qatar Airways. Growing up surrounded by pilots, many expected Daiana Crimpita to follow the same path.
Yet, becoming cabin crew was never her childhood dream. She thought she would take a different route. But after her year in America, aviation called to her in a way she had not anticipated.
Thanks to the discipline and responsibility she learned from her family and experiences, she adapted quickly. Her years in Dubai strengthened her resilience and deepened her desire to help others find their own path.
Today, Daiana Crimpita coaches aspiring cabin crew in the Middle East. She helps them overcome the challenges of this demanding career and guides them to succeed with confidence and emotional balance.
